Commit Graph

  • c988e5466f Merge pull request #61 from 0x4bs3nt/feat/builtin-nuclei main automated-release-c988e54 Celeste Hickenlooper 2026-01-11 16:39:18 -08:00
  • 0a387fac9d fix: rename to snakecase 0x4bs3nt 2026-01-07 22:39:19 +01:00
  • c8059411bf fix: renamed nuclei module file 0x4bs3nt 2026-01-07 22:33:49 +01:00
  • f1d3b93f34 fix: colorizer exception 0x4bs3nt 2026-01-07 19:06:51 +01:00
  • 9a78ca07c7 fix(nuclei): logdir, headless option and hosterrorscache 0x4bs3nt 2026-01-07 17:01:22 +01:00
  • 860a43a8fa fix: nuclei scan nil pointer dereference 0x4bs3nt 2026-01-07 15:09:49 +01:00
  • 01d0533c3f feat(modules): legacy nuclei scan 0x4bs3nt 2026-01-07 13:07:35 +01:00
  • 57f597bbb1 feat(modules): infra for builtin modules 0x4bs3nt 2026-01-07 12:56:17 +01:00
  • d9dd3dc40c Merge pull request #56 from 0x4bs3nt/feat/astro-framework-detection automated-release-d9dd3dc Celeste Hickenlooper 2026-01-06 12:10:34 -08:00
  • 0a0f8d0a11 fix: adjust generator meta weight jan 2026-01-06 14:45:03 +01:00
  • 02bb8aed1b Merge pull request #55 from 0x4bs3nt/docs/contributing-update automated-release-02bb8ae Celeste Hickenlooper 2026-01-05 23:50:02 -08:00
  • 2879dc2ae7 fix: discord invite jan 2026-01-06 06:35:32 +01:00
  • fe0119b437 fix: use dynamic versioning for debian packages automated-release-fe0119b Celeste Hickenlooper 2026-01-05 20:55:30 -08:00
  • 1fdedb7f49 docs: update CONTRIBUTING.md 0x4bs3nt 2026-01-06 05:30:34 +01:00
  • ef96746357 docs: add apt/cloudsmith installation instructions and badge automated-release-ef96746 automated-release-6a67031 Celeste Hickenlooper 2026-01-05 20:28:30 -08:00
  • 6a67031c39 ci: push debian packages to cloudsmith Celeste Hickenlooper 2026-01-05 20:28:07 -08:00
  • f53d739fa7 ci: add debian package builds to releases automated-release-f53d739 Celeste Hickenlooper 2026-01-05 20:13:18 -08:00
  • a36993a908 docs: add 0xatrilla to contributors for AUR packaging automated-release-a36993a automated-release-9267d9d automated-release-04db9be Celeste Hickenlooper 2026-01-05 19:51:50 -08:00
  • 04db9be896 docs: add AUR and Homebrew badges to readme Celeste Hickenlooper 2026-01-05 19:48:51 -08:00
  • 9267d9d682 Merge pull request #53 from 0xatrilla/add-aur-install-instructions Celeste Hickenlooper 2026-01-05 19:44:43 -08:00
  • 961db21b2a chore: revise arch linux installation section in README Celeste Hickenlooper 2026-01-05 19:44:15 -08:00
  • cceb165f3f feat(frameworks): add Astro framework detection 0x4bs3nt 2026-01-06 04:40:15 +01:00
  • d3d8da2b6b docs: add AUR installation instructions acxtrilla 2026-01-06 01:56:40 +00:00
  • cb22206967 docs: add homebrew installation instructions automated-release-cb22206 Celeste Hickenlooper 2026-01-05 16:53:16 -08:00
  • 6df11f8284 chore: readme inconsistency automated-release-6df11f8 Celeste Hickenlooper 2026-01-03 06:14:40 -08:00
  • ec51fb69b9 ci: upgrade to go 1.24 in all workflows automated-release-ec51fb6 automated-release-6c44c6d automated-release-1e7f713 Celeste Hickenlooper 2026-01-03 06:04:33 -08:00
  • 6c44c6dc6f chore: add license headers to missing files automated-release-061c5fb Celeste Hickenlooper 2026-01-03 06:01:00 -08:00
  • 1e7f713bf8 feat(output): add styled console output with module loggers Celeste Hickenlooper 2026-01-03 05:51:26 -08:00
  • 4942425ce5 docs: add comprehensive documentation and fix github actions Celeste Hickenlooper 2026-01-03 03:39:58 -08:00
  • c7598a1d3f docs: update readme and add module documentation Celeste Hickenlooper 2026-01-03 03:21:24 -08:00
  • 6a2d1664e7 feat: show module loading and execution logs by default Celeste Hickenlooper 2026-01-03 03:20:02 -08:00
  • 9f053850e6 feat: add debug logging for module execution Celeste Hickenlooper 2026-01-03 03:18:10 -08:00
  • f4c4d79add refactor: move pkg/scan to internal/scan Celeste Hickenlooper 2026-01-03 03:10:19 -08:00
  • 3e67164da2 fix: add io.LimitReader and proper error handling to shodan.go Celeste Hickenlooper 2026-01-03 02:58:22 -08:00
  • f6e53740f0 fix: add io.LimitReader to prevent memory exhaustion Celeste Hickenlooper 2026-01-03 02:58:16 -08:00
  • 0210b55753 fix: regex compilation performance Celeste Hickenlooper 2026-01-03 02:58:10 -08:00
  • 0a65acdfff feat: implement loadYAML in module loader Celeste Hickenlooper 2026-01-03 02:53:04 -08:00
  • d7c4387413 feat: integrate module system into sif.go Celeste Hickenlooper 2026-01-03 02:51:16 -08:00
  • 3239bfd046 feat: add module cli flags Celeste Hickenlooper 2026-01-03 00:56:21 -08:00
  • aac5d48cbd feat: add built-in yaml modules for security scanning Celeste Hickenlooper 2026-01-03 00:54:53 -08:00
  • e92650fb16 feat: add yaml module parser and http executor Celeste Hickenlooper 2026-01-03 00:53:16 -08:00
  • 04da73b79c feat: add module system infrastructure Celeste Hickenlooper 2026-01-03 00:48:29 -08:00
  • 3ae61080fe refactor: move config to internal Celeste Hickenlooper 2026-01-03 00:47:40 -08:00
  • 6b209bfb38 refactor: move logger to internal Celeste Hickenlooper 2026-01-03 00:47:12 -08:00
  • 49ecfccb4a refactor: rewrite framework detection with modular detector architecture Celeste Hickenlooper 2026-01-03 00:07:46 -08:00
  • 09347bc908 feat: add generic types and type-safe result handling Celeste Hickenlooper 2026-01-02 23:55:17 -08:00
  • 79b60a5259 refactor: extract cve database to separate file Celeste Hickenlooper 2026-01-02 23:47:03 -08:00
  • a922b77b1e perf: precompile framework version regex patterns Celeste Hickenlooper 2026-01-02 23:45:06 -08:00
  • 06d896b2a5 fix: response body leaks in cms.go and sql.go Celeste Hickenlooper 2026-01-02 23:37:45 -08:00
  • 953b912a3b fix: response body leak in scan.go robots processing Celeste Hickenlooper 2026-01-02 23:36:22 -08:00
  • 0f1c2b1799 feat: add generic worker pool for concurrent task processing Celeste Hickenlooper 2026-01-02 22:59:45 -08:00
  • 29f817d935 perf: optimize deduplication with map-based o(1) lookups in lfi and sql Celeste Hickenlooper 2026-01-02 22:58:21 -08:00
  • 534d2605fd fix: data races and slice preallocation in dirlist and dnslist Celeste Hickenlooper 2026-01-02 22:56:06 -08:00
  • 6d505b90a3 fix: error patterns and string building in sif.go and js/scan.go Celeste Hickenlooper 2026-01-02 22:54:55 -08:00
  • 18ab70fc35 test: add logger tests for buffered write functionality Celeste Hickenlooper 2026-01-02 22:53:05 -08:00
  • 6f9a5ce9e8 refactor: logger to use buffered file handles Celeste Hickenlooper 2026-01-02 22:52:23 -08:00
  • d7cf882a8d chore: remove unused utils package Celeste Hickenlooper 2026-01-02 22:50:49 -08:00
  • a18a4fae31 ci: add test coverage reporting to workflow Celeste Hickenlooper 2026-01-02 22:50:28 -08:00
  • 8a8156d474 ci: enhance golangci-lint with additional linters Celeste Hickenlooper 2026-01-02 22:49:49 -08:00
  • 97de4f89df Merge pull request #51 from andrewgazelka/chore/modernize-nix-flake automated-release-97de4f8 Celeste Hickenlooper 2026-01-03 00:38:59 -08:00
  • 20acf4ad96 chore(nix): modernize flake to use buildGoModule Andrew Gazelka 2026-01-03 00:25:37 -08:00
  • 9e71b512b1 docs: update contributor name and add vxfemboy automated-release-9e71b51 automated-release-3ecfdf8 Celeste Hickenlooper 2026-01-02 19:56:44 -08:00
  • 3ecfdf8bba chore: fix contributorrc Celeste Hickenlooper 2026-01-02 19:55:31 -08:00
  • 302b27e1bf chore: fix contributorrc Celeste Hickenlooper 2026-01-02 19:51:03 -08:00
  • 8fb797dd3a Merge pull request #40 from vmfunc/feat/framework-detection automated-release-8fb797d Celeste Hickenlooper 2026-01-02 19:15:07 -08:00
  • 3735534ae7 fix: adjust sif logo alignment feat/framework-detection Celeste Hickenlooper 2026-01-02 19:12:28 -08:00
  • 78a385d4f4 fix: improve version detection and add documentation Celeste Hickenlooper 2026-01-02 19:04:37 -08:00
  • 95a03b91d7 docs: add framework detection to readme Celeste Hickenlooper 2026-01-02 18:54:24 -08:00
  • 8a0945619b feat: expand framework detection with cvs, version confidence, concurrency Celeste Hickenlooper 2026-01-02 18:51:23 -08:00
  • eb77282873 chore: add license header to detect.go Celeste Hickenlooper 2026-01-02 18:25:32 -08:00
  • 11589e90fe feat: improve framework detection with more signatures and tests Celeste Hickenlooper 2026-01-02 18:18:59 -08:00
  • 05c01653cb chore(actions): add framework to CI vmfunc 2024-11-22 10:45:21 -05:00
  • 6552aa8887 feat(framework-detection): weighted bayesian detection algorithm vmfunc 2024-11-22 03:48:34 -05:00
  • 1eac29757c feat: framework detection module vmfunc 2024-11-22 03:20:32 -05:00
  • 7ff0d04902 fix: use static discord badge instead of server id automated-release-a998052 automated-release-7ff0d04 automated-release-612df34 automated-release-44842dd automated-release-3ba18a9 Celeste Hickenlooper 2026-01-02 18:45:07 -08:00
  • a9980524df docs: update readme with new modules and discord link automated-release-2cfdc51 Celeste Hickenlooper 2026-01-02 18:42:45 -08:00
  • 612df34a5f feat: add lfi reconnaissance module (#49) Celeste Hickenlooper 2026-01-02 18:41:30 -08:00
  • 3ba18a956a feat: add sql reconnaissance module (#48) Celeste Hickenlooper 2026-01-02 18:40:06 -08:00
  • 44842dd659 fix: remove duplicate subdomain takeover call and add config tests (#46) Celeste Hickenlooper 2026-01-02 18:38:47 -08:00
  • 2cfdc511f0 Merge pull request #47 from vmfunc/feat/shodan-integration Celeste Hickenlooper 2026-01-02 18:35:56 -08:00
  • ac879e069c feat: add shodan integration for host reconnaissance feat/shodan-integration Celeste Hickenlooper 2026-01-02 18:24:37 -08:00
  • 816ecd1e46 fix: update dependencies to address security vulnerabilities automated-release-816ecd1 Celeste Hickenlooper 2026-01-02 18:03:27 -08:00
  • 42d16bd68c fix: update readme badges and use banner image automated-release-80ca5a1 automated-release-42d16bd Celeste Hickenlooper 2026-01-02 17:54:17 -08:00
  • 80ca5a1de3 fix: update banner, badges, and header check automated-release-a0d6719 Celeste Hickenlooper 2026-01-02 17:49:00 -08:00
  • a0d6719fc6 chore: delete old license automated-release-df6ca79 Celeste Hickenlooper 2026-01-02 17:45:14 -08:00
  • df6ca7924b license: switch to bsd 3-clause, update headers and readme Celeste Hickenlooper 2026-01-02 17:41:18 -08:00
  • 421965e993 test: add basic unit tests for scan package automated-release-421965e Celeste Hickenlooper 2026-01-02 17:27:50 -08:00
  • a945afffd0 chore: add golangci-lint configuration Celeste Hickenlooper 2026-01-02 17:21:58 -08:00
  • 1199fdf815 docs: update minimum go version to 1.23 in contributing guide Celeste Hickenlooper 2026-01-02 17:21:38 -08:00
  • a26888bd3c fix: handle errors instead of ignoring them Celeste Hickenlooper 2026-01-02 17:21:21 -08:00
  • dba9c4b3ab chore: update github actions to latest versions Celeste Hickenlooper 2026-01-02 17:20:01 -08:00
  • 0e4de7872e chore: upgrade to go 1.25 and ignore claude files Celeste Hickenlooper 2026-01-02 17:13:16 -08:00
  • e2ac47d5ce Merge pull request #41 from vmfunc/dependabot/go_modules/go_modules-dd59f798d0 Celeste Hickenlooper 2026-01-02 17:11:27 -08:00
  • 63c125ea1c fix: update go version check to support go 1.20+ Celeste Hickenlooper 2026-01-02 17:10:05 -08:00
  • 942a2409bc Merge pull request #43 from ag-wnl/agwnl/update-makefile-go Celeste J. 2025-10-26 17:22:41 +01:00
  • bef84ce9e7 Update README.md automated-release-bef84ce celeste 2025-04-18 16:41:37 +02:00
  • 16bf3f6ae3 chore: update to be compatible with all minor Go updates ag-wnl 2025-03-15 15:26:09 +05:30
  • a9c4c1f8af chore: update makefile to latest go version ag-wnl 2025-03-15 15:19:54 +05:30
  • f1430de4a0 build(deps): bump github.com/quic-go/quic-go in the go_modules group dependabot[bot] 2024-12-02 17:51:08 +00:00
  • a40b78c820 actions<breaking>: remove PR-specific actions vmfunc 2024-11-22 03:28:17 -05:00